Output d901c9dcb447967fa7a4f534a655ee5c5f835ac398727987ed61444f50f9abcb:0

value
508972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45fe8eae80e3530878541c18f213785f154c7ef9 OP_EQUAL
address
3857VjaBazaFaTwbLcs95QfXsHuU5HQP1X
transaction
d901c9dcb447967fa7a4f534a655ee5c5f835ac398727987ed61444f50f9abcb
confirmations
156497
spent
true